Dead Coin Battery

If the key fob of your Nissan Juke has stopped working, check the battery in the coin. It could be dead and requires to be replaced. This is a simple fix that only takes a few minutes. It's as easy as flipping the fob over and accessing the tiny latch/release located on the back. Take out the old battery and then put in the new one, making sure it's facing down in the fob. If the fob was exposed to water, it needs to be cleaned before putting the new battery in. This can be accomplished by using a paper towel along with isopropyl alcohol or electronic cleaner, and allowing it to dry completely before re-inserting battery.

The key fob also needs to be paired with the vehicle to start it, which can be accomplished by following the instructions in the owners manual or an OBDII scanner. The most likely reason the key fob stopped working is that it wasn't paired. A faulty chip in the fob can also cause it to stop working however this is not a common occurrence. A new receiver module could be required in this scenario. If this is the case, it will need to be replaced by a certified technician.

Faulty Chip

The key fob of your nissan leaf key fob Juke contains a special chip that transmits a signal to the vehicle whenever you turn it. The key could stop working if the chip is faulty. If this happens it is only possible to fix the problem by replacing the key. The nissan juke replacement key uk Juke key may be damaged due to several reasons, including water damage or the battery of your coin is dead.

Check the chip for any water damage in the event that your key fob stopped working after a wash or bath. Make sure that the metal retainers are in good shape and that the chip is not exposed to any water. If you observe any signs of water damage, try removing the battery and wiping down the electronic component using isopropyl alcohol, or electronic cleaner.

If the chip is faulty, you will need to visit your local locksmith or dealer. In order to find a replacement, they will need the year, model and year of your car. It is also necessary to write down the V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) to ensure that the locksmith or dealer can identify the key you have. This will enable them to look up the correct key code, and also ensure that they are cutting the right one.

Faulty Receiver Module

The key fob transmits a radio signal to your vehicle to perform various functions. The key fob can unlock your trunk as you rush with your groceries to the car or even start your car by pressing the fob's button. It can also open your windows and turn on the horn if you accidentally lock the keys inside your car.

If the key fob stops working, it could be problems with the receiver unit in the vehicle. The receiver modules are tuned so they can detect specific frequencies that correspond to signals generated by nissan juke replacement key key fobs. If your car has a faulty receiver module is damaged, it will cease to respond to any signal received from the key fob.
